The street in brief

Northumberland Avenue is a street almost entirely of flats. Homes here typically change hands around £997,500 — roughly 19% below the WC2N nor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across WC2N prices have held broadly level over the last few years. With 9 sales across 6 homes since 2004, homes here come to market only r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
